What are the responsibilities and job description for the CPR/First Aid Instructor position at Golden Years Adult Day Care?
Job Summary
We are seeking a dedicated and knowledgeable First Aid Instructor to join our team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for educating individuals in first aid, CPR, and emergency response techniques. This role requires excellent communication skills and the ability to engage participants in a classroom setting. The First Aid Instructor will develop lesson plans, conduct training sessions, and ensure that all participants are equipped with the necessary skills to respond effectively in emergency situations.
Duties
- Conduct engaging first aid and CPR training sessions for diverse groups of participants.
- Develop comprehensive lesson plans that align with established training standards.
- Utilize effective public speaking techniques to communicate key concepts clearly.
- Assess participant understanding through practical demonstrations and written evaluations.
- Maintain a safe and supportive learning environment that encourages questions and interaction.
- Stay current with industry standards and best practices in first aid and emergency response.
- Provide feedback to participants on their performance and areas for improvement.
- Collaborate with other instructors to enhance the overall training program.
Qualifications
- Certification in First Aid and CPR is required; additional certifications such as Lifeguard or Adult Education are preferred.
- Proven experience in public speaking and classroom instruction.
- Strong communication skills with the ability to educate a diverse audience effectively.
- Experience in lesson planning and curriculum development is highly desirable.
- Ability to engage participants through interactive teaching methods.
- A commitment to fostering a positive learning environment.
